The cheapest way to get from Malesherbes to Lorris is to bus and line 12 bus via Halte Patis Office du Tourisme which costs €6 and takes 2h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Malesherbes to Lorris is to drive which takes 50 min and costs €8 - €12.
No, there is no direct bus from Malesherbes to Lorris. However, there are services departing from Gare SNCF and arriving at Musée de la Résistance via Perruchot.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 32m.
The distance between Malesherbes and Lorris is 77 km. The road distance is 51.8 km.
The best way to get from Malesherbes to Lorris without a car is to bus and line 12 bus via Halte Patis Office du Tourisme which takes 2h 32m and costs €6.
It takes approximately 2h 32m to get from Malesherbes to Lorris, including transfers.
Malesherbes to Lorris bus services, operated by Réseau de Mobilité Interurbaine (Rémi), depart from Gare SNCF station.
Malesherbes to Lorris bus services, operated by Réseau de Mobilité Interurbaine (Rémi), arrive at Halte Patis Office du Tourisme station.
Yes, the driving distance between Malesherbes to Lorris is 52 km. It takes approximately 50 min to drive from Malesherbes to Lorris.
